Transaction 3bf58eb6a82a9ca0765b0873c09db244874f886f48119d96fe0f55e26a665378
1 Input
1 Output
-
3bf58eb6a82a9ca0765b0873c09db244874f886f48119d96fe0f55e26a665378:0
- value
- 178158
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0ba21fcac843ce4b260ee96979dc56d664ed874 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L2eXdeAxgsrwacZobZfLRfNKDcQTz1hBA